Definition And Characteristics Of Mini FPV Drones

Mini FPV drones are small, lightweight unmanned aerial vehicles equipped with a camera that provides a real-time video feed to the pilot. These drones are specifically designed for FPV flying, allowing users to experience the thrill of flight from a first-person perspective. With their agile maneuverability and high-speed capabilities, mini FPV drones are perfect for racing, aerial acrobatics, and capturing breathtaking footage.

Features And Specifications Of Mini FPV Drones

Mini FPV drones come in various models, each with its own unique features and specifications. They typically have a lightweight frame, powerful brushless motors, and a flight controller that ensures stability and responsiveness. The camera systems vary in quality, ranging from basic resolution to high-definition options. Additionally, mini FPV drones often have customizable settings, allowing users to optimize performance to their preferences.

Use Cases and Applications Of Mini FPV Drones

Mini FPV drones have a wide range of applications. Drone racing is one of the most thrilling and competitive activities in the FPV community. Pilots navigate their drones through challenging courses, pushing their skills to the limit. These drones are also used for aerial photography and cinematography, capturing stunning shots from unique perspectives. Furthermore, mini FPV drones serve as a valuable tools for exploration, search and rescue operations, and even educational purposes.

Frame And Design

Mini FPV drones feature lightweight frames constructed from durable materials such as carbon fiber or high-grade plastics. The frame design plays a crucial role in maintaining the drone’s stability and withstanding crashes or impacts.

Flight Controller And Motors

The flight controller is the brain of the mini FPV drone, processing inputs from the pilot and ensuring a stable flight. High-quality flight controllers offer advanced features like GPS positioning, altitude hold, and stabilization algorithms. Brushless motors provide the necessary power and responsiveness for agile flight maneuvers.

Camera And Video Transmission Systems

The camera is an integral part of the mini FPV drone setup, allowing pilots to see the world from the drone’s perspective. The video feed is transmitted wirelessly to the pilot’s goggles or monitor. The quality of the camera and video transmission system significantly affects the visual experience during flights and the quality of recorded footage.

Battery And Flight Time

Mini FPV drones are typically powered by rechargeable lithium polymer (LiPo) batteries. Flight time varies depending on the drone’s specifications and the capacity of the battery. It is essential to consider battery life when choosing a mini FPV drone to ensure longer flying sessions and uninterrupted enjoyment.

Remote Control And Receiver

The remote control or transmitter is the interface between the pilot and the drone. It provides control over the drone’s flight movements, camera adjustments, and other settings. The receiver on the drone receives signals from the remote control, translating the pilot’s commands into action.

Understanding Your Skill Level And Experience

Assess your skill level and experience before purchasing a mini FPV drone. Beginners may want to start with a more entry-level model, while experienced pilots might prefer advanced features and capabilities.

Researching And Comparing Mini FPV Drone Models

Take the time to research and compare different mini FPV drone models. Consider factors such as flight performance, camera quality, durability, and customer reviews to make an informed decision.

Considering Camera Quality And Resolution

If capturing high-quality footage is a priority, pay attention to the camera’s resolution and image stabilization features. Some mini FPV drones offer interchangeable cameras or the ability to upgrade the camera system.

Checking Battery Life And Flight Time

Evaluate the battery life and flight time of the mini FPV drone. Longer flight times allow for extended exploration and more enjoyable flying sessions. It’s also worth considering the availability and cost of spare batteries.

Practicing Open And Safe Areas

When flying your mini FPV drone, choose open and safe areas away from people, buildings, and other potential obstacles. Ensure compliance with local regulations and respect the privacy of others.

Upgrading Camera Systems And Video Transmitters

For those seeking better image quality or a longer transmission range, upgrading the camera system and video transmitter can enhance the FPV experience.

Adding GPS Modules For Positioning And Navigation

GPS modules can provide valuable positioning data and assist with navigation, especially for longer-range flights or autonomous flight modes.

Enhancing The Remote Control System

Upgrading the remote control system can offer additional features, improved ergonomics, and better range, providing a more satisfying piloting experience.

Using Different Types Of Propellers

Experimenting with different propellers can affect the drone’s flight characteristics, such as speed, maneuverability, and efficiency. Some propellers are designed for specific purposes like racing or aerial photography.

Exploring FPV Goggles And Monitors

FPV goggles or monitors are essential for an immersive FPV experience. Goggles provide a more immersive and enclosed viewing experience, while monitors offer a wider field of view and can be shared with others.

Adhering To Local Laws And Regulations

Before flying a mini FPV drone, familiarize yourself with local laws and regulations regarding drone operations. Ensure you comply with restrictions on flying in certain areas, altitude limits, and privacy concerns.

Flying In Designated Flying Areas

Whenever possible, fly your mini FPV drone in designated flying areas or clubs. These areas provide a controlled environment with proper safety measures and allow you to interact with fellow enthusiasts.

Maintaining Line Of Sight And Avoiding Obstacles

Maintain a visual line of sight with your mini FPV drone at all times. Be aware of your surroundings and avoid flying near obstacles, people, or other aircraft. Maintain a safe distance from structures and respect the privacy of others.

Taking Precautions To Protect People And Property

Exercise caution when flying near people or property. Be mindful of your drone’s flight path and the potential risks associated with unexpected maneuvers or technical failures. Prioritize safety and respect the rights and safety of others.

Conducting Regular Maintenance And Inspections

Regularly inspect and maintain your mini FPV drone to ensure it is in optimal condition. Check for any signs of damage, loose connections, or wear and tear. Follow manufacturer guidelines for maintenance and consult professionals when needed.

1. What Does FPV Mean In The Context Of Mini Drones?

FPV stands for First-Person View. It refers to the real-time video transmission from the mini drone’s onboard camera to the pilot’s goggles or monitors, providing an immersive flying experience.

2. What Is The Flight Range Of Mini FPV Drones?

The flight range of mini FPV drones can vary depending on the model and the transmission system used. Some models have a range of a few hundred meters, while others can reach several kilometers with the use of long-range transmission systems.

3. Can I Use Virtual Reality (VR) Goggles With Mini FPV Drones?

Yes, many mini FPV drones are compatible with virtual reality (VR) goggles. VR goggles offer a more immersive experience by providing a 3D view of the drone’s flight.

4. Are Mini FPV Drones Suitable For Beginners?

Yes, mini FPV drones can be suitable for beginners. It’s recommended to start with a more beginner-friendly model and practice in open areas to develop flying skills gradually.

5. What Safety Precautions Should I Take When Flying A Mini FPV Drone?

Always follow local laws and regulations, maintain a line of sight, avoid flying near people or property, and conduct regular maintenance on your drone. Additionally, consider joining a local drone community or club to learn from experienced pilots and share safety tips.
